THE SOUP BIBLE

All the soups you will ever need in one inspirational collection - over 200 recipes from around the world

- Tasty soups for every occasion: warming pottages, hearty broths, creamy chowders, rich bisques, classic consommés, chilled soups and elaborate gumbos.

- A world-wide selection of enticing recipes - from classic French Vichyssoise to Hungarian Sour Cherry; from Thai Fish Soup to hearty Italian Minestrone; and from comforting Scotch Broth to American Creamy Oyster Soup.

- A comprehensive introduction includes step-by-step recipes for creating the perfect stock and suggests garnishes for a professional finish.

- With 800 step-by-step photographs.

All the soups any cook could ever want are here in one stunning collection. Here is an international selection of enticing soups: choose from British Creamy Tomato, Seafood Gumbo from Louisiana, Moroccan Harira with Lamb and Chick-peas, and many others. Select an aromatic soup for a delicious appetizer or a hearty broth for a healthy lunch. Make a smooth bisque to impress your guests or cook up a chunky soup - big enough to be a meal in itself.

The introduction has basic recipes for a wide range of stocks.

With 800 photographs, informative text, easy-to-follow steps and superb recipes, this is an essential guide to the art of soup-making.

About the Editor:

Debra Mayhew, who compiled this volume with some of today's best recipe developers and home economists, is a highly experienced writer, food consultant and culinary editor.
